Comparing Iraq with Tempe Junction, Arizona

Compare Climate information for Iraq and Tempe Junction, Arizona

Is Iraq warmer or hotter than Tempe Junction, Arizona?

On average across the year, yes, Iraq is hotter than Tempe Junction, Arizona . Iraq has an average temperature of 27°C/81°F and Tempe Junction, Arizona has an average temperature of 25°C/77°F.

Iraq's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 47°C/117°F, which is hotter than Tempe Junction, Arizona's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 41°C/106°F).

Is Iraq colder or cooler than Tempe Junction, Arizona?

On average across the year, no, Iraq is not colder than Tempe Junction, Arizona . Iraq has an average minimum temperature of 20°C/68°F and Tempe Junction, Arizona has an average minimum temperature of 18°C/64°F.



Iraq's coldest month is January, with an average minimum temperature of 8°C/46°F, which is approximately the same temperature as Tempe Junction, Arizona's coldest month (December, with an average minimum temperature of 8°C/46°F).

Does Iraq have more rain than Tempe Junction, Arizona?

On average across the year, no, Iraq has less rain than Tempe Junction, Arizona. Iraq has an average annual rainfall of 95mm and Tempe Junction, Arizona has an average annual rainfall of 181mm.

Iraq's wettest month is November, with an average monthly rainfall of 21mm, which is drier than Tempe Junction, Arizona's wettest month (August, with an average monthly rainfall of 29mm).
